The function of an uninterruptible power supply (UPS) system is to provide emergency power to critical devices when the main power source fails. A UPS not only offers backup power for computers and telecommunication equipment but also protects these devices from electrical disturbances. It ensures that devices continue functioning during power interruptions, thereby preventing data loss and equipment damage245. [pdf]

A power inverter changes DC power from a battery into conventional AC power that you can use to operate all kinds of devices . electric lights, kitchen appliances, microwaves, power tools, TVs, radios, computers, to name just a few. [pdf]
